>>> Thanks to the trace file provided in Bug 721687, I was able to
>>> quickly track this down to a call to
>>> g_win32_locale_filename_from_utf8. Removing that call fixed the
>>> problem for me on a US edition of Win7 Home Pro, but I’m concerned
>>> about folks with non-English Windows editions, particularly XP. I’d
>>> appreciate it if everyone with such installations can test tomorrow
>>> morning’s (in the Eastern US time zone) nightly build. It will be
>>> at http://code.gnucash.org/builds/win32/trunk/ and will have a
>>> filename like gnucash-2.6.0-2014-01-17-git-xxxxxxx+-setup.exe with
>>> some hex gibberish instead of the row of ‘x’s.
>>> 
>>> For those interested, the change is r23700.

>> I've just tested the nightly build under XP with Italian locale and it
>> works. Thanks for your work John!

> I'm not sure though that our European languages are "foreign" enough to trigger the bug.
> 
> To be sure we'd need a tester for languages such as Russian, Chinese, or similar. Those 
> that have a different code page on Windows than the Western code page.

Heh, it was reported by a Russian and even French triggered the bug.

But Cristian, do you have an Italian edition of Windows?
